Biology Exam 2 VCE Unit 4, 3rd edition is an invaluable tool for Year 12 students preparing to sit the mid-year VCE Biology exam. It is specifically designed to address the latest 2006-2012 VCE Study Design.

It contains nine practice exams for VCE Biology Units 3 and Unit 4 (2006–2012 Study Design) respectively. A separate, comprehensive solutions book is included with both so teachers can control students’ access to answers.

Test 1 Molecular genetics: genome, gene expression, DNA and RNA, nuclear enzymes, DNA replication, genetic code, transcription and translation

Test 2 Above plus: Transmission of heritable characteristics, genes as units of inheritance, gene regulation, eukaryote chromosomes, prokaryote chromosomes and plasmids; Cell reproduction: cell cycle, apoptosis, binary fission, gamete production; inputs and outputs of meiosis; diploid and haploid, n and 2n

Test 3 Above plus: Patterns of inheritance in sexually reproducing organisms: One gene locus: monohybrid cross including dominance, recessiveness, co-dominance; multiple, alleles, monohybrid cross: dominant/recessive, test cross, pedigree analysis. Sex linkage. Genotype, phenotype and environment

Test 4 Above plus: inheritance at two gene loci: dihybrid cross. Linked genes and recombination; Gene interactions. Pedigrees of all of the above. Types of mutations. Polygenes, continuous and discontinuous variation

Test 5 Above plus: DNA manipulation: tools and techniques including recombinant DNA, amplification of DNA, gel electrophoresis, DNA profiling, DNA sequencing; cloning of genes, transformation; gene delivery systems

Test 6 Above plus: change in populations: gene pool, allele frequencies; selection pressures, genetic drift, founder effect, gene flow. Natural selection. Speciation. Extinction – bottlenecks. Geological time: scale; relative and actual dating techniques

Test 7 Above plus: patterns of evolution: divergent, convergent; branching diagrams. Evidence of evolution: fossil record, biogeography, comparative anatomy, molecular evidence; Homologous and analogous structures

Test 8 Above plus: primate and human evolution. Human influences on evolution. Applications of gene technologies

Test 9 Detachable Examination Whole course.
